Group 2: Rongchang Biopharmaceuticals - Rongchang Biopharmaceuticals entered a significant overseas licensing agreement for Taitasip with Vor Bio, with a headline amount of $1.25 billion upfront plus up to $4.1 billion in milestone payments. However, the core terms fell short of market expectations [1][2]. - The upfront payment structure was less favorable than anticipated, with only $45 million in cash and the remainder in warrants, leading to lower actual cash inflow compared to previous licensing deals [2]. - The milestone payments of up to $4.1 billion are contingent on multiple conditions, including clinical and regulatory approvals, with high uncertainty regarding the development of Taitasip for U.S. SLE indications [2]. Group 3: Risk Factors - The unique risk structure of innovative drug companies makes their stock prices sensitive to single events, such as critical data releases for ongoing clinical trials [3]. - Rongchang Biopharmaceuticals reported a loss of nearly 1.47 billion in 2024, with Q1 2025 operating cash flow still negative at 188 million [4]. - The competitive landscape for Taitasip faces challenges from FcRn inhibitors and other therapies, raising questions about the sustainability of clinical advantages [4]. Core Viewpoint - Rongchang Biologics has entered into a licensing agreement with Vor Biopharma Inc. for the proprietary product Taisip, granting Vor Bio exclusive rights for development and commercialization outside Greater China, which is expected to enhance the company's brand value and international influence [1][3]. Group 1: Licensing Agreement Details - The licensing agreement includes a total payment of $125 million from Vor Bio to the company, comprising a $45 million upfront payment and $80 million in warrants [2]. - Vor Bio is obligated to pay up to $4.105 billion in milestone payments based on clinical development progress and post-launch sales performance [2]. - The agreement establishes a joint strategic committee to coordinate the global development and commercialization of the licensed product [2][3]. Group 2: Warrant Issuance - Vor Bio will issue warrants valued at $80 million to Rongpu Partnership, allowing the partnership to purchase 320 million shares of Vor Bio at an exercise price of $0.0001 per share [3]. - The exercise of the warrants is contingent upon shareholder approval and regulatory approvals from Chinese authorities [3]. Group 3: Strategic Implications - The agreements are expected to accelerate the overseas market expansion of Taisip, providing innovative treatment options for global patients [3]. - The partnership is anticipated to enhance the company's cash flow while diversifying research and development risks [3].

Group 1 - Heptagon Pharma announced the latest progress in its core patent rights protection, with the National Intellectual Property Administration maintaining the validity of its "combination molecule" patent, which involves the use of transgenic animals to produce fully human heavy chain antibodies (HCAb) [1] - The "combination molecule" patent is central to Heptagon Pharma's Harbour Mice® platform, which has established collaborations with several well-known pharmaceutical companies globally, indicating significant commercial value [1] Group 2 - Yunnan Baiyao's JZ-14 capsule, a first-in-class small molecule immunomodulator developed by its subsidiary, has received clinical trial approval, showing significant immunomodulatory and anti-proliferative activity in ulcerative colitis and various tumor models [2] - Successful clinical translation of JZ-14 could fill a gap in the immunomodulation field and expand Yunnan Baiyao's presence in chemical drug innovation [2] Group 3 - Rongchang Bio's product, Taihetai (RC18), has received orphan drug designation from the European Commission for the treatment of myasthenia gravis, which provides various policy supports including scientific advice on development plans and a ten-year market exclusivity post-approval [3] Group 4 - Merck's Clesrovimab (MK-1654) injection application is proposed for priority review by the National Medical Products Administration, aimed at preventing lower respiratory tract infections caused by RSV in newborns and infants entering or born during the RSV season [4] - Clesrovimab's long-acting protective characteristics may alter the current RSV prevention landscape, necessitating attention to its competitive differentiation from vaccines and pricing strategies [4]
